On 7/1/20 6:05 PM, Joseph Myers wrote: > In TS 18661-1, getpayload had an unspecified return value for a > non-NaN argument, while C2x requires the return value -1 in that case. Reviewed TS 18661-1 F.10.13.1 getpayload and confirmed the result is unspecified for non-NaN argument case. Confirmed in N2454 that if *x is not a NaN that the result shall be -1 (not unspecified as in TS 18661-1). > This patch implements the return value of -1. I don't think this is > worth having a new symbol version that's an alias of the old one, > although occasionally we do that in such cases where the new function > semantics are a refinement of the old ones (to avoid programs relying > on the new semantics running on older glibc versions but not behaving > as intended). > > Tested for x86_64 and x86; also ran math/ tests for aarch64 and > powerpc. OK for mater. Reviewed-by: Carlos O'Donell <carlos@redhat.com> > --- > > Carlos, is this OK at the current slush development stage? Yes it is. I consider this a "forward looking" change that while making a semantic change is within the scope of a bug fix. > diff --git a/manual/arith.texi b/manual/arith.texi > index 89c2c064f1..75eaf67fe7 100644 > --- a/manual/arith.texi > +++ b/manual/arith.texi > @@ -1895,9 +1895,10 @@ propagated from NaN inputs to the result of a floating-point > operation.
